Dead Coin Battery

If the key fob on your Nissan Juke has stopped functioning, make sure you check the battery for coins. It could be dead and needs to be replaced, which is a straightforward fix that only takes some minutes. It's as easy as flipping the fob upside down and opening the tiny latch/release on the back. Replace the battery that was in use with the new one, making sure it's facing the bottom of the fob. Make sure to align the two halves carefully.

If the fob was exposed to water, it will need to be cleaned prior to putting the new battery in. You can clean the fob with isopropyl electronic cleaner and a paper towel. Then let it dry completely before reinstalling the battery.

Faulty Chip

The key fob of your Nissan Juke contains a special chip that transmits a signal to the vehicle each time you turn it. The key could be inoperable because the chip is malfunctioning. In this situation it is only possible to fix the problem by replacing the key. There are several reasons why your Nissan Juke's key could be defective, such as water damage or a dead coin battery or a damaged receiver module.

Check the chip for any water damage If your key fob has stopped working after a bath or wash. Make sure the metal clips holding it are not loose and that the chip is not exposed to any water. If you notice any indications of water damage, you can try removing the battery and cleaning the electronic component using isopropyl ethanol or electronic cleaner.

If the chip is defective If it is damaged, you should visit your local locksmith or dealer. To find a replacement, they will need the year, make and model of your car. You'll also need to write down your VIN (Vehicle ID Number) so the dealer or locksmith will know what key you have. This will enable them to search for the correct key code and confirm that they cut the right one.
